Default Front Lower Ball Joint Leaking...no kidding!!

While working on my prop valve I noticed that something was leaking onto both of my front tires. It turned out to be my lower ball joints!! Have any of you heard of the grease liquefying in the lower ball joint? I did weld them in about a year ago and have since re-greased them with the Valvoline Syn grease that I have always used. Is there a way to drain these things??
